Glasgow Rangers midfielder Aribo doubtful for Super Eagles AFCONQ vs Lesotho
Published: March 29, 2021
Glasgow Rangers midfielder Joe Aribo has been rated as doubtful to make his eighth appearance for the Super Eagles in Tuesday's dead-rubber 2021 Africa Cup of Nations qualifying match against Lesotho at the Teslim Balogun Stadium.
The former Charlton Athletic star is battling to overcome a stomach issue less than twenty four hours before the tie against the Crocodiles.
Aribo has emerged as a key player for the Super Eagles since starring on his debut against Ukraine, starting every single game they have played in the Africa Cup of Nations qualifiers so far.
Speaking at the end of training on Monday, Rohr said : "The training was okay, we had a long time to come here because of the traffic but the training was okay, we trained for one hour and fifteen minutes of good work.
"Unfortunately there is one player Joe Aribo who has stomach problems so we are not sure he'll play tomorrow. "
Semi Ajayi, Wilfred Ndidi, Oghenekaro Etebo and Abdullahi Shehu are the other players classed as midfielders in the Nigeria squad for this month's matches.
